Intern - Engineering (Automation)
Coherent Corp.
Description for Intern Candidates
Primary Duties & Responsibilities
- Collaborate with the Engineering and Automation Team to understand process requirements for automating manual cleaning of optics/lens using a robotic arm.
- Assist in the development and implementation of a robotic system (In-house automation) to replicate and standardize manual cleaning processes while ensuring consistency and quality.
- Support programming of robotic arm motion, including path planning, force control (if applicable), and repeatability for delicate optics handling.
- Conduct process trials to optimize cleaning parameters such as motion path, pressure, speed, and cleaning coverage.
- Perform testing, debugging, and troubleshooting of the robotic cleaning system to prevent damage and ensure process reliability.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Process) to validate cleaning performance and meet quality standards.

Coherent is a global leader in lasers, engineered materials and networking components. We are a vertically integrated manufacturing company that develops innovative products for diversified applications in the industrial, optical communications, military, life sciences, semiconductor equipment, and consumer markets.
